ASTM F150-06(2018)

Standard Test Method for Electrical Resistance of Conductive and Static Dissipative Resilient Flooring

1.1 This test method covers the determination of electrical conductance or resistance of resilient flooring either in tile or sheet form, for applications such as hospitals, computer rooms, clean rooms, access flooring, munition plants, or any other environment concerning personnel-generated static electricity.
